Another thing to add to your to do list, is to get a No Claims Certificate from each car insurance company you have been covered by. To get any no claims discount, ICBC will need proof from every company, not just the current one.

Originally Posted by BCtoAB
Another thing to add to your to do list, is to get a No Claims Certificate from each car insurance company you have been covered by. To get any no claims discount, ICBC will need proof from every company, not just the current one.
Any letter from insurers you get, make sure they have:
1. The date the policy started and ended
2. The name(s) of those covered
3. Whether there were any claims made against the policy

The no claims bit (in BC at least) isn't really recognised unless the above information is included. It took me about 5 months to get it all sorted out, and with car insurance being so expensive here, it's well worth getting right!
